As a Phlebotomy Specialist with TalentBurst, you will play a vital role in ensuring the smooth operation of our patient service centers. Your primary responsibility will be to collect blood samples from patients in a safe and efficient manner, while maintaining a high level of customer service and professionalism.
Key Responsibilities:
- Collect blood samples from patients using a variety of techniques, including venipuncture and capillary collection.
- Prepare blood samples for laboratory testing, ensuring that all necessary information is accurately recorded and documented.
- Provide exceptional customer service to patients, responding to their needs and concerns in a timely and professional manner.
- Work effectively in a fast-paced environment, prioritizing tasks and managing time to meet productivity and quality standards.
- Collaborate with other healthcare professionals to ensure seamless patient care and efficient laboratory operations.
Requirements:
- High school diploma or equivalent required; medical training or certification preferred.
- At least three years of phlebotomy experience, including pediatric and geriatric collections.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with patients, colleagues, and management.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team, with a strong focus on customer service and quality.
- Flexibility to work a variety of shifts, including weekends and holidays, as needed.
